TypeScript 语言 常见调试工具与 TypeScript

TypeScriptamuwap 发布于 13 小时前 1 次阅读


阿木博主一句话概括:TypeScript 调试工具深度解析:提升开发效率的利器

阿木博主为你简单介绍:
TypeScript 作为 JavaScript 的超集,在大型项目开发中扮演着重要角色。高效的调试工具能够显著提升开发效率,本文将围绕 TypeScript 语言,深入探讨几种常见的调试工具及其使用方法,帮助开发者更好地掌握 TypeScript 的调试技巧。

一、

随着前端项目的日益复杂,TypeScript 的应用越来越广泛。在开发过程中,调试是必不可少的环节。本文将介绍几种在 TypeScript 开发中常用的调试工具,包括浏览器调试工具、IDE 调试工具和命令行调试工具,帮助开发者快速定位问题,提高开发效率。

二、浏览器调试工具

1. Chrome DevTools

Chrome DevTools 是最常用的浏览器调试工具之一,它提供了丰富的调试功能,包括控制台、网络、源代码、应用等面板。

(1)控制台面板:用于输出日志、执行 JavaScript 代码等。

(2)网络面板:用于查看网络请求的详细信息,包括请求头、响应体等。

(3)源代码面板:用于查看和编辑 JavaScript 代码,设置断点等。

(4)应用面板:用于查看和修改 DOM、CSS、JavaScript 等资源。

2. Firefox Developer Tools

Firefox Developer Tools 提供了与 Chrome DevTools 类似的调试功能,包括控制台、网络、源代码、应用等面板。

三、IDE 调试工具

1. Visual Studio Code

Visual Studio Code 是一款轻量级、可扩展的代码编辑器,它内置了强大的 TypeScript 调试功能。

(1)设置断点:在 TypeScript 代码中,通过鼠标点击行号或使用快捷键(Ctrl + F8)设置断点。

(2)单步执行:使用快捷键(F8)进入下一个断点,或使用(F10)单步执行。

(3)查看变量:在调试过程中,可以查看当前作用域下的变量值。

(4)监视表达式:通过监视表达式,可以实时查看表达式的值。

2. WebStorm

WebStorm 是一款功能强大的 JavaScript 和 TypeScript 集成开发环境,它提供了丰富的调试功能。

(1)设置断点:与 Visual Studio Code 类似,通过鼠标点击行号或使用快捷键设置断点。

(2)单步执行:使用快捷键(F8)进入下一个断点,或使用(F10)单步执行。

(3)查看变量:在调试过程中,可以查看当前作用域下的变量值。

(4)监视表达式:通过监视表达式,可以实时查看表达式的值。

四、命令行调试工具

1. TypeScript 的调试脚本

TypeScript 提供了一个命令行工具,可以用于编译和调试 TypeScript 代码。

(1)编译 TypeScript 代码:使用 `tsc` 命令编译 TypeScript 代码。

(2)调试 TypeScript 代码:使用 `tsc --watch` 命令启动 TypeScript 编译器,并监视文件变化。在调试过程中,可以使用 `node --inspect` 命令启动 Node.js 应用,并连接到调试器。

2. Node.js 的调试脚本

Node.js 提供了 `--inspect` 和 `--inspect-brk` 两个命令,用于启动调试器。

(1)`--inspect`:启动 Node.js 应用,但不立即中断执行。

(2)`--inspect-brk`:启动 Node.js 应用,并在第一行代码处中断执行。

五、总结

本文介绍了 TypeScript 开发中常用的调试工具,包括浏览器调试工具、IDE 调试工具和命令行调试工具。通过掌握这些调试工具的使用方法,开发者可以更高效地定位和解决问题,提高开发效率。

在 TypeScript 开发过程中,选择合适的调试工具至关重要。希望本文能帮助开发者更好地掌握 TypeScript 的调试技巧,为项目开发保驾护航。